Music Mode : Playing Music Files

Playing Music Files

You can play back stored music files.
1. Turn the Mode Dial to

Music

mode.

2. Press the [POWER] button to turn on the Miniket

Photo.

3. The last file played back is displayed.

◆ If there is no music file stored, the message “No

Stored Music!” appears.

4. Select a music file to play by moving the joystick

left / right button, and then press the joystick (OK).

5. The selected music file is played back.

◆ To pause playback, press the joystick (OK).

◆ To stop playback, press and hold the joystick

(OK) for more than 3 seconds.

◆ To search backward / forward during playback, hold

down the joystick left or right for a while.

◆ Holding the joystick left / right for more than 1

second while stopped will skip to the previous / next
file rapidly.

◆ To adjust volume, move joystick up / down.

Volume indicator appears and disappears after few
seconds.

[ Notes ]

✤ If a broken file name is displayed, try renaming it on a PC.

✤ When the earphones or AV (Audio / Video) cable is connected to the

Miniket Mhoto, the built-in speaker will turn off automatically.

✤ Miniket Photo only supports MP3 file format.

✤ Damaged or non-standard MP3 files may not displayed properly or

failed to play back.

✤ Playback will fail to start if the first file is damaged.

✤ The title may not be displayed if the language is not supported or in

Chinese.

✤ MP3 files with VBR setting will appear as VBR on the LCD monitor and

its play time and recording time may differ from the displayed figure.

✤ A file which does not comply with the MP3 standard, even if the file

extension is MP3, will not display / play back.
